iv already proved that is impossible. Even the Oslon would not hit 2 million. The throwing ability is 25% better based off the difference between the Xhp35 led and the CFT90 led in the TN42 host using real numbers. the bigger host will have the same 25% of throw improvement. Based on this guys estimate this led would need to have a 63% increase in throw over the xhp35 and its no where close. Now the led is not driven to its max in the tn42vn90. lets add 1000 more lumens and raise the throw Increase to 35%. So if the CFT90 throws 35% better in the GT over the Xhp35 then we get 1.7 million lux. and that is being generous. Im not trying to get you mad or anything i just dont want you to be dissapointed if its only 1.6m lol. and btw 1.6million and 5000 lumens is quite revolutionary in its own right.

The GT is an astronomically larger host than the TN42, that might explan the major heat difference. XHP35 HI gets up to around 2500 lumen at around 2.5 amp. The GT is close to that output at 2amps. The extra half an amp really doesn't make too much of a difference. The designers of the GT purposefully kept the highest output at 2 amps because they saw no benefit to the 1-200 lumen gain for a big drop in efficiency.

The color difference shouldn't matter too much as the 4000k is the highest output bin for the XHP35 HI.


If you wanted something very different from stock light, the Black Flat will give a laser beam.

GT is 2.5 Amps as well. Double click turbo is higher than ramp turbo
